Taxes in Locust Hill township, North Carolina

The sales tax rate in Locust Hill township, North Carolina is 6.9%. Last year, the average property taxes paid was 0.7% Locust Hill township, North Carolina.

The state income tax in the state of North Carolina is 4.99%.

Housing costs in Locust Hill township, North Carolina

  • The average cost of a single-family home compared to USAmoderate
  • The average cost of a single-family home compared to North Carolinalow

In Locust Hill township, North Carolina, 83.0% of the population owns their homes, while approximately 17.0% rent. The average cost of a single-family home in Locust Hill township, North Carolina in 2022 is $212,426 which is moderateAnalytics team at Dwellics grouped locations into 5 ranges for each metric: Lowest, Low, Moderate, High, Highest in the United States and lowAnalytics team at Dwellics grouped locations into 5 ranges for each metric: Lowest, Low, Moderate, High, Highest in North Carolina. The average one-bedroom apartment cost is approximately $737 per month.
